怎么把本地库交到远程库git
-
将本地仓库推送到远程仓库的步骤如下:
1. 在本地仓库中初始化Git:打开命令行窗口,进入本地仓库所在的目录,通过命令`git init`初始化Git。
2. 关联远程仓库:使用命令`git remote add origin 远程仓库的URL`将本地仓库与远程仓库建立关联。远程仓库的URL可以从远程仓库提供商的页面上获取,如GitHub或GitLab。
3. 添加文件到本地仓库:通过命令`git add 文件名`将需要提交的文件添加到本地仓库。
4. 提交文件到本地仓库:使用命令`git commit -m “提交信息”`将添加的文件提交到本地仓库。提交信息是对本次提交的简要说明,可以根据实际情况进行更改。
5. 推送本地仓库到远程仓库:通过命令`git push -u origin 分支名`将本地仓库推送到远程仓库。其中,分支名是要推送的分支名称,通常为主分支`master`。第一次推送时需要添加`-u`参数,之后的推送可以省略。
6. 输入远程仓库的用户名和密码:在推送到远程仓库时,可能需要输入远程仓库的用户名和密码进行身份验证。
7. 等待推送完成:推送到远程仓库可能需要一些时间,等待推送完成。
完成上述步骤后,本地仓库中的文件就会被推送到关联的远程仓库中。
补充说明:在推送前,建议先使用`git pull origin 分支名`命令进行一次合并操作,以防止远程仓库有新的提交而导致冲突。另外,推送前也可以使用`git status`命令查看当前仓库的状态和待提交的文件列表。
2年前 -
将本地库提交到远程库有多种方法,其中最常用的方法是使用Git命令行工具。下面是一种常用的方法来将本地库提交到远程库:
1. 在本地库创建一个与远程库相对应的空白远程库。可以使用Git命令`git clone`复制远程库的URL来创建本地副本。例如,执行以下命令克隆远程库:
“`
git clone <远程库URL>
“`2. 进入本地库的目录。在你的本地库根目录下执行以下命令:
“`
cd <本地库目录>
“`3. 添加文件到本地库。将你想要提交到远程库的文件添加到本地库中。可以使用`git add`命令来添加文件。例如,执行以下命令添加所有文件:
“`
git add .
“`4. 提交到本地库。使用`git commit`命令将你的更改提交到本地库。例如,执行以下命令提交更改:
“`
git commit -m “提交信息”
“`5. 将本地库的更改推送到远程库。使用`git push`命令将你的本地库的更改推送到远程库。例如,执行以下命令推送到远程库:
“`
git push origin master
“`这个命令将本地库的master分支推送到远程库的master分支。
6. 输入你的远程库的用户名和密码。如果你在远程库上有权限,那么你需要输入你的用户名和密码来完成推送操作。
完成上述步骤后,你的本地库将被提交和推送到远程库中。
还有其他的方法可以将本地库提交到远程库,比如使用图形化界面的Git客户端等。无论你选择哪种方法,只要你能够完成上述步骤,你就能将你的本地库成功提交到远程库中。
2年前 -
将本地库推送到远程库是使用Git的常见操作之一。接下来,我将介绍详细的操作流程。
1. 创建远程库:
在使用Git之前,您需要先在远程平台(如GitHub、GitLab或Bitbucket等)上创建一个空远程库。登录到远程平台,然后按照指导操作创建一个新的远程库。2. 初始化本地库:
在本地电脑上打开命令行终端,进入您的项目所在的目录。然后使用以下命令初始化本地库:
“`
git init
“`3. 将文件添加到本地库:
将项目中的所有文件添加到本地库中,使用以下命令:
“`
git add .
“`4. 提交变更:
提交文件的变更到本地库,并添加一个描述信息,使用以下命令:
“`
git commit -m “提交描述信息”
“`5. 关联远程库:
将本地库与远程库关联起来,使用以下命令:
“`
git remote add origin 远程库URL
“`
其中,远程库URL是您在第1步创建远程库时获得的URL。6. 推送变更:
使用以下命令将本地库的变更推送到远程库:
“`
git push -u origin master
“`
这里的`origin`是远程库的别名(一般默认为origin),`master`是默认的主分支。7. 输入用户名和密码:
如果您在远程平台上创建远程库时进行了身份验证,那么在推送时可能需要输入用户名和密码进行身份验证。8. 查看远程库:
使用以下命令验证是否成功将本地库推送到远程库:
“`
git remote -v
“`
这会显示与本地库关联的远程库的详细信息。至此,您已成功将本地库推送到远程库中。以后,您可以使用`git push`命令将新的变更推送到远程库中。
2年前